Transaction 0139b0826646c6623697efecf1133e49c42701ea2d13da3041f635b30f898509

1 Input
2 Outputs
  • 0139b0826646c6623697efecf1133e49c42701ea2d13da3041f635b30f898509:0
  • value  10834700
    address  3MM9RZ3s8mjQVdbk4ejNcK7PXMVYVV2GfW
  • 0139b0826646c6623697efecf1133e49c42701ea2d13da3041f635b30f898509:1
  • value  19036710
    address  1PtzdVwugEtFMdpq5Gd3u4QG2vk3FTiXc6